    Abstract: In the new shaped articles a hollow space or a lumpy inorganic base material is surrounded by a porous silica-containing layer. They can be prepared by applying silica sol or a mixture containing water, silica sol and/or waterglass and, if appropriate, finely pulverulent water-insoluble silica and/or porosity producing agents to a lumpy base material, and, if use is made of organic base materials, then removing these organic base materials by heating. The new shaped articles can be used as support material for catalysts or, if the layer containing the porous silica contains catalytically active substances, as catalysts.

    Abstract: A process for the preparation of a trichlorobenzene by chlorination of o-dichlorobenzene in the presence of a catalyst is disclosed. The catalyst comprises aluminum chloride. Preferably an iron or iron chloride containing aluminum chloride catalyst is employed.

    Abstract: Technically pure 2,4-diisocyanatotoluene or an isomer mixture having an increased 2,4-diisocyanatotoluene content is obtained from an isomer mixture of 2,4- and 2,6-diisocyanatotoluene. The 2,4- and 2,6-diisocyanatotoluene mixture is first cooled to a temperature of from 4.degree. to 9.degree. C. and further cooled to between -2.degree. to -6.degree. C. at a rate of 0.5.degree. to 3.degree. C. per hour. The temperature of the mixture is maintained at that temperature for at least 30 minutes. Any liquid present is removed and the solid remaining is then melted. Melting is preferably carried out by heating the solid at a rate of 0.5.degree. to 3.degree. C. per hour until the remaining solid has a 2,4-diisocyanatotoluene content of at least 98%. The liquid melt is removed and the solid having the desired 2,4-diisocyanatotoluene content is then melted.

    Abstract: A process for the preparation of 2-chlor-4-nitrotoluene is disclosed by chlorination of 4-nitrotoluene in the presence of iodine. The resultant 2-chloro-4-nitrotoluene is a valuable intermediate for the preparation of herbicides.

    Abstract: A process for separating ortho-, meta-, and/or para-dichlorobenzene from an isomeric mixture thereof which comprises:A. in a first step, distilling said isomeric mixture to distill over meta- and/or para-dichlorobenzene to leave behind ortho-dichlorobenzene which is separated off as bottoms product;B. in a second step, cooling the distillate from step A to a temperature of 10.degree. to 40.degree. C. whereby para-dichlorobenzene as a solid phase is obtained and separating said solid phase from liquid phase with which it is in admixture;C. in a third step, further cooling said liquid phase from step B to a temperature of -40.degree. to -5.degree. C. whereby to precipitate a second solid phase and separating said second solid phase from the liquid phase with which it is in admixture;D. in a fourth step, distilling the liquid phase from step C whereby to obtain an isomeric mixture as bottoms and an isomeric mixture as distillate; andE. removing m-dichlorobenzene from the distillate of step D.
